I have everything working like a charm (two 250 tuners) and I just hooked it all up to the TV in the living room. After a small modification to make it output on the TV, there is a small, small problem:

The video on the TV now has a small, but noticable stutter. It just "jumps" a tiny amount, otherwise it all looks and works like a charm. Do I need a better TV OUT (maybe the pvr 350) or XCard, or is there something else I can do?

yes, I am new at this, so any help is appreciated.

Try a different MPEG decoder on the playback tab of the config app - I'm sure this will fix the problem.
